Advanced Temperature Control Technology

Advanced Temperature Control Technology

The price of butt fusion machine reflects sophisticated temperature management systems that ensure optimal welding conditions for consistent joint quality across diverse applications. Modern machines incorporate precision heating elements with uniform heat distribution patterns that eliminate hot spots and temperature variations that could compromise weld integrity. These advanced control systems feature microprocessor-based monitoring that continuously tracks heating plate temperatures and automatically adjusts power output to maintain precise thermal conditions throughout the fusion cycle. The temperature control technology justifies the price of butt fusion machine through enhanced reliability and reduced operator error potential. Digital displays provide real-time temperature feedback with accuracy levels that exceed manual monitoring capabilities, while programmable parameters accommodate various polyethylene formulations and environmental conditions. The heating elements utilize specialized alloys and surface treatments that resist oxidation and thermal cycling fatigue, ensuring consistent performance over extended operational periods. Professional-grade models feature dual-zone temperature control that optimizes heating patterns for different pipe wall thicknesses and diameter ranges. The price of butt fusion machine encompasses comprehensive thermal management that includes automatic preheat cycles, temperature stabilization phases, and controlled cooling sequences that optimize molecular bonding between pipe surfaces. These systems incorporate safety interlocks that prevent operation outside acceptable temperature ranges, protecting both equipment and workpiece integrity. The advanced temperature control technology reduces cycle times through efficient heating patterns while maintaining quality standards that meet or exceed industry specifications. Users benefit from consistent fusion quality regardless of ambient temperature conditions or operator experience levels, as the automated systems compensate for environmental variables that traditionally affected joint quality.
Hydraulic Clamping and Alignment Systems

Hydraulic Clamping and Alignment Systems

The price of butt fusion machine includes precision hydraulic systems that deliver consistent clamping forces and maintain perfect alignment throughout the welding process. These sophisticated mechanisms ensure proper pipe positioning and prevent movement during heating and cooling phases that could result in misaligned or weakened joints. The hydraulic components feature robust construction with corrosion-resistant materials that withstand harsh environmental conditions while maintaining precision performance over extended service periods. Professional operators recognize that the price of butt fusion machine reflects engineering excellence in hydraulic design that delivers repeatable results across thousands of welding cycles. The clamping systems incorporate adjustable pressure settings that accommodate various pipe materials and wall thicknesses without causing deformation or surface damage. Precision alignment guides ensure concentric positioning that optimizes fusion area contact and prevents offset conditions that could create stress concentration points in the finished joint. The hydraulic systems feature smooth operation characteristics that minimize vibration and movement during critical fusion phases, while quick-release mechanisms facilitate efficient pipe insertion and removal procedures. Advanced models include digital pressure monitoring that displays real-time clamping force information and alerts operators to pressure variations that could affect joint quality. The price of butt fusion machine encompasses comprehensive hydraulic functionality that includes automatic pressure compensation for thermal expansion effects during heating cycles. These systems incorporate safety features that prevent over-clamping damage while ensuring adequate holding force for secure pipe retention throughout the welding process. Users benefit from consistent alignment accuracy that eliminates angular misalignment issues common with manual positioning methods, while the hydraulic assist features reduce operator fatigue during repetitive welding operations in demanding field conditions.
Comprehensive Quality Assurance and Documentation Features

Comprehensive Quality Assurance and Documentation Features

The price of butt fusion machine encompasses advanced quality assurance capabilities that provide comprehensive documentation and traceability for critical welding applications. Modern machines incorporate data logging systems that automatically record welding parameters including temperature profiles, heating times, cooling durations, and pressure readings for each completed joint. These documentation features justify the price of butt fusion machine through enhanced regulatory compliance and quality control capabilities that meet stringent industry standards. The integrated monitoring systems capture real-time data throughout the entire fusion cycle, creating permanent records that demonstrate adherence to specified welding procedures and quality requirements. Professional models feature removable data storage devices that facilitate easy transfer of welding records to project management systems and quality assurance databases. The documentation capabilities include automatic time and date stamping that creates audit trails for welding activities, while operator identification systems ensure accountability and traceability for quality control purposes. Advanced quality assurance features include automatic parameter verification that compares actual welding conditions against predetermined specifications and alerts operators to deviations that could affect joint integrity. The price of butt fusion machine reflects sophisticated software integration that generates detailed reports including statistical analysis of welding parameters and quality trends across multiple projects. These systems incorporate visual and audible alarm functions that immediately notify operators of conditions outside acceptable ranges, preventing completion of substandard joints that could compromise system reliability. Users benefit from reduced inspection costs and simplified quality documentation procedures that streamline project acceptance and regulatory approval processes. The comprehensive quality assurance features provide valuable feedback for continuous improvement initiatives while maintaining detailed records that support warranty claims and performance analysis requirements.
